This is Ex Nihilo's plush, delicate offering, a 'stealth wealth' whisper of a scent that divides opinion: some find it an ethereal dream, others a 'meh' skin scent. It's a gorgeous, if subtle, composition for those who prefer their elegance understated.
This "your skin but better" scent is either a serene, salty-sweet sandalwood dream or a complete scrubber that smells like baby sick or melting plastic. It's divisive, but fans adore its understated, clean vibe, despite its fleeting nature.
